About Caffè Nero
Caffè Nero is a premium Italian-inspired café that offers a warm and welcoming atmosphere for people who want to relax, meet friends, or work in a cozy environment. We are conveniently located at Unit 27a, New Street Station, Birmingham B2 4QA, United Kingdom, which is easily accessible by public transport or by car.
Our café prides itself on serving high-quality coffee that is made by trained baristas using only the best Arabica beans from sustainable sources. We also offer a wide selection of food options, from sandwiches, panini, cakes, pastries, and snacks, which are made fresh every day using locally sourced ingredients. Our food and drinks menu caters to various dietary requirements, including vegetarian and gluten-free options.
Caffè Nero is not just a café but a point of interest for tourists and locals alike. Our cozy and relaxed interiors feature rustic wooden furnishings, soft lighting, and comfortable seating that are perfect for catching up with friends, reading a book, or working on your laptop. Our café also hosts various events throughout the year, such as live music, art exhibitions, and themed menu nights, making us a popular destination for those seeking cultural experiences.
Our store is also equipped with free Wi-Fi and ample charging points, making us an ideal spot for digital nomads and remote workers looking for a place to work or hold a meeting. Our trained staff members are friendly and knowledgeable, and they are always on hand to help with any inquiries or offer coffee tasting tips to enhance your experience.
